Back to home page

OSCL-LXR

 
 

    


0001 Link Layer Validation Device is a standard device for testing of Super
0002 Speed Link Layer tests. These nodes are available in sysfs only when lvs
0003 driver is bound with root hub device.
0004 
0005 What:           /sys/bus/usb/devices/.../get_dev_desc
0006 Date:           March 2014
0007 Contact:        Pratyush Anand <pratyush.anand@gmail.com>
0008 Description:
0009                 Write to this node to issue "Get Device Descriptor"
0010                 for Link Layer Validation device. It is needed for TD.7.06.
0011 
0012 What:           /sys/bus/usb/devices/.../u1_timeout
0013 Date:           March 2014
0014 Contact:        Pratyush Anand <pratyush.anand@gmail.com>
0015 Description:
0016                 Set "U1 timeout" for the downstream port where Link Layer
0017                 Validation device is connected. Timeout value must be between 0
0018                 and 127. It is needed for TD.7.18, TD.7.19, TD.7.20 and TD.7.21.
0019 
0020 What:           /sys/bus/usb/devices/.../u2_timeout
0021 Date:           March 2014
0022 Contact:        Pratyush Anand <pratyush.anand@gmail.com>
0023 Description:
0024                 Set "U2 timeout" for the downstream port where Link Layer
0025                 Validation device is connected. Timeout value must be between 0
0026                 and 127. It is needed for TD.7.18, TD.7.19, TD.7.20 and TD.7.21.
0027 
0028 What:           /sys/bus/usb/devices/.../hot_reset
0029 Date:           March 2014
0030 Contact:        Pratyush Anand <pratyush.anand@gmail.com>
0031 Description:
0032                 Write to this node to issue "Reset" for Link Layer Validation
0033                 device. It is needed for TD.7.29, TD.7.31, TD.7.34 and TD.7.35.
0034 
0035 What:           /sys/bus/usb/devices/.../u3_entry
0036 Date:           March 2014
0037 Contact:        Pratyush Anand <pratyush.anand@gmail.com>
0038 Description:
0039                 Write to this node to issue "U3 entry" for Link Layer
0040                 Validation device. It is needed for TD.7.35 and TD.7.36.
0041 
0042 What:           /sys/bus/usb/devices/.../u3_exit
0043 Date:           March 2014
0044 Contact:        Pratyush Anand <pratyush.anand@gmail.com>
0045 Description:
0046                 Write to this node to issue "U3 exit" for Link Layer
0047                 Validation device. It is needed for TD.7.36.
0048 
0049 What:           /sys/bus/usb/devices/.../enable_compliance
0050 Date:           July 2017
0051 Description:
0052                 Write to this node to set the port to compliance mode to test
0053                 with Link Layer Validation device. It is needed for TD.7.34.
0054 
0055 What:           /sys/bus/usb/devices/.../warm_reset
0056 Date:           July 2017
0057 Description:
0058                 Write to this node to issue "Warm Reset" for Link Layer Validation
0059                 device. It may be needed to properly reset an xHCI 1.1 host port if
0060                 compliance mode needed to be explicitly enabled.